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Tablet Kiosk For Self Check-in Workflows

Choosing the right tablet kiosk for self check-in involves understanding your specific environment and workflow needs. A well-selected kiosk not only secures devices from theft but also provides a seamless experience for users. Consider the environment—public, semi-private, or private—and how that influences your security and usability priorities. Additional factors like peripheral compatibility, installation complexity, and future expansion should also inform your decision. Making the right choice requires balancing these elements to ensure long-term value and operational efficiency.

Security and Theft Prevention

For self check-in workflows, security features such as lockable enclosures, anti-theft hardware, and tamper-resistant mounts are essential. Public environments demand more robust security to prevent theft or vandalism, which can lead to costly replacements or downtime. However, overly secure setups might complicate user access or maintenance, so finding a balance is key. Consider whether you need a lockable enclosure or a floor stand with a secure base. Security should always align with the environment’s risk level and operational needs.

Adjustability and Ergonomics

An adjustable kiosk ensures that users of different heights can comfortably interact with the device, reducing frustration and improving accessibility. Ergonomic design also means considering tilt and rotation features, which can facilitate better viewing angles and ease of use. This is especially important in environments with diverse user demographics. Be wary of models with fixed mounts if your use case requires flexibility, as poor ergonomics can hinder productivity and user satisfaction.

Compatibility with Peripherals

Many self check-in workflows rely on peripherals like printers, card readers, or scanners. Choosing a kiosk compatible with these devices can streamline operations and reduce setup costs. Integrated printing for badges or receipts often enhances user experience but may increase the complexity and cost of the kiosk. Always verify peripheral compatibility and consider future needs—buying a flexible, upgradeable model can save money over time.

Installation and Maintenance

Ease of installation can significantly impact total cost of ownership. Floor stands typically require more setup but offer greater security and flexibility, whereas countertop models are simpler to deploy but may lack the stability needed for high-traffic use. Maintenance considerations include accessibility for repairs and cleaning, especially in busy environments. Choosing a model with straightforward access points and durable construction will reduce downtime and ongoing costs.

Cost and Future Scalability

While budget constraints are real, investing in a higher-quality kiosk with advanced security, adjustable features, and peripheral compatibility can provide better value over time. Cheaper models might seem attractive initially but often lack durability or security features needed for long-term use. Consider your future needs—if you plan to expand your workflow or integrate more peripherals, selecting a scalable and versatile kiosk now can prevent costly replacements later.

Frequently Asked Questions

How secure should my self check-in kiosk be?

The security level depends on your environment. For high-traffic or public spaces, a kiosk with a lockable enclosure, anti-theft hardware, and a sturdy mount is advisable to prevent theft or vandalism. In private or controlled environments, a simpler enclosure may suffice, but security should still be a priority to protect your device and data. Assess your risk level and choose a model that balances security with ease of use for your staff and users.

Can I add peripherals like printers or scanners to these kiosks?

Most kiosks designed for self check-in workflows are compatible with common peripherals such as printers, scanners, or card readers. Some models have built-in integration options or dedicated ports, making workflow automation more seamless. However, not all stands support peripherals equally—some may require additional accessories or upgrades. Verify peripheral compatibility before purchase to ensure your workflow remains smooth and future-proof.

Are floor-standing kiosks more secure than countertop options?

Generally, floor-standing kiosks offer increased security because they are more difficult to move or tamper with, especially when bolted down. They also tend to have more robust locking mechanisms and enclosure options. Countertop kiosks, while easier to deploy, can be more vulnerable to theft, especially in open or semi-public spaces. The choice ultimately depends on your environment’s security needs and available space.

What should I consider regarding installation and ongoing maintenance?

Ease of installation varies; floor stands often require more initial setup and securing, but they tend to be more durable and flexible. Countertop options are simpler to deploy but may need more frequent replacement if they lack durability. Maintenance considerations include ease of access for repairs, cleaning, and peripheral upgrades. Selecting a model with accessible panels and durable construction can significantly reduce operational disruptions.

How much should I budget for a high-quality self check-in kiosk?

Pricing varies widely based on features, security, and peripherals. Basic models may start around a few hundred dollars, while advanced kiosks with integrated printers, locks, and adjustable features can cost over a thousand dollars. Investing in a higher-quality kiosk often pays off through durability, security, and streamlined workflows. Consider your long-term needs and whether the additional upfront cost will deliver better value over time.
